Excellence of sending alāt upon the Prophet صَلَّی اللہ عَلَیْہِ واٰلِہٖ وَ سَلَّمَ

The final Prophet of Allah صَلَّى الـلّٰـهُ ع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م said:

مَنْ صَلَّی عَلَیَّ  فِیْ  یَوْمٍ اَلْفَ مَرَّۃٍ لَمْ یَمُتْ حَتَّی یَرٰی مَقْعَدَہُ مِنَ الْجَنَّۃِ

Translation:Whoever recites ṣalāt upon me one thousand times in a day, he will not die until he sees his abode in Paradise.”[1]

The beloved Prophet صَلَّى الـلّٰـهُ ع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م has stated: اَفْضَلُ الْعَمَلِ اَلنِّيَّۃُ الصَّادِقَۃُ,A truthful intention is the best action.”[2] O devotees of the Prophet! Make good intentions before every action, as this can be a means of entering Paradise. Before listening to the speech, make good intentions, such as:

*   You will listen to the entire speech to gain the knowledge of Islam.

*   You will sit in a respectful manner.

*   You will refrain from acting lazy during the speech.

*   You will listen to the speech to reform yourself.

*   Whatever you hear and learn, you will try to convey it to others.
